Default Post Guidelines: PLEASE READ BEFORE POSTING

hey guys,
so i just figured that this is needed. more and more people are coming in to this forum, because it is the best place to go on the net. AF rules! however, it is getting more and more difficult to make sure that this forum flows well. if you look at the past few days you will notice that more and more post are getting moved around. so i hope that this post will help direct people to the right subforum.

the evo forum is divided into 5 subforums:

1.HTC EVO 4G- this is the general evo subforum and anything pertaining to the evo in general will go here. Basically if you have a question with the evo specifically like "how" or "why", this is not the section to post.

2.Support andTroubleshooting- if you have any issues, problems or just questions on how to do something, this is the place to go.

3.All things Rooting-this section is for anything having to deal with being rooted. this also includes if you need to unroot. regardless of the topic if you are rooted, please ask it in this subforum.

4.Tips and Tricks-if you have any ideas or tips or how to's, this is the subforum for you.

5.Accessories-anything related to accessories should go into this subforum.

so please make sure that you are posting in the right subforum. it will definitely ensure that you get the most views and exposures as well as answers. and before you hit the submit button, check that your topic has not been talked about. when you type in a topic, it will show you other similar posts. if something that has already been discussed, please do not create a new post. also do a search before posting as well.

also if you have a question and it was answered for you, please hit the THANKS button to show your appreciation for the answer.

and if you see any posts that offends you or you feel you have been attacked unfairly please report it. To the left of the post is a report button. the mods will be notified and will laydown the law.

and one last thing please follow Site Rules/Guidelines. and just so you know, we have a Zero Tolerance Policy as well.
